Intraperitoneal administration of Dianeal with 4.25% dextrose creates an osmotic gradient across the peritoneal membrane, promoting ultrafiltration and removal of uremic toxins and excess fluid.
Intraperitoneal administration of Dianeal PD-1 with 4.25% dextrose creates an osmotic gradient across the peritoneal membrane, promoting ultrafiltration of fluid and removal of uremic solutes (e.g., urea, creatinine) through diffusion and convection.
Intraperitoneal administration: 2 liters infused over 10-20 minutes, dwell time 4-6 hours, then drain over 15-20 minutes; 4 exchanges per 24 hours.
Intraperitoneal administration; dose individualized based on body size, residual renal function, and dialysis adequacy. Typical regimen: 2-2.5 L instilled into peritoneal cavity for a dwell time of 4-8 hours, 4-5 exchanges per day in continuous ambulatory peritoneal dialysis (CAPD).
